Soweto Remix Lyricism

The term “soweto” is a term in African pidgin language meaning a lady’s backside, Victony states that he cannot get enough and is highly obsessed with it as any man can be.

The song starts off with Victony calling out his friend to call all the “brokotos” he can find saying “Oya make you dey call all the brokoto” which is a slang for luscious and attractive women, he then tells his friend not to be sluggish with this request “No go dey slogodo oh!”.

Victony then proceeds to confirm his own feelings of arousal by saying “body dey draw me like Ogbono”, Ogbono being a popular African soup that is known for its irresistible taste. He also talks about the girl he is feeling and how she makes him feel “bololo dey craze me” which is a reference to his male organ, he then asks her to take control and appreciate her body “Make I salute your commodore”.

The Soweto remix by Victony ft Don Toliver, Rema and Tempoe is a celebration of a woman’s beauty, a woman that the artist has fallen for and wants to give the world to her.

The chorus encapsulates Victony’s promise of showering the girl with designer goodies and money. He then further adds that if he “lap” your Soweto, it’s like a tornado, referring to the strong effect it has on him.

The second verse is built on the first with the new verse implying that another man, Tunde, is equally obsessed with the girl’s backside. “Tunde do dey craze o” implies that Tunde is so charmed by her that he is going crazy for her.
